Accounting

What are lessons like in this subject?

Studying Accounting will allow you to develop a range of numerical skills that you are able to apply to real world situations, proving a vital skill for businesses when making decisions. You will cover a range of accounting techniques that can be applied to small businesses such as sole traders, all the way up to large conglomerates. You will also be given further opportunities to apply Accounting to the real world with competitions such as BASE Accounting that will enable you to apply the skills covered in lessons to the wider world of Business.

What will I study?

The course covers the basic principles of accounting right through to advanced considerations such as ethics in accounting.

Topics include:

  • The role of the accountant
  • The key elements of the foundation of accounting and double entry book keeping
  • The preparation, analysis and evaluation of financial statements, including how to use ratio analysis to compare the performance of businesses and wider considerations
  • Accounting for sole traders and partnerships.
